Origins and Evolution
Baseball is often viewed as “The us’s pastime,” with Qualified leagues courting again on the 19th century. Softball, initially known as “indoor baseball,” was invented in 1887 in Chicago. It absolutely was at first a leisure version of baseball, created for indoor Perform through the Winter season months. After some time, it evolved into a competitive Activity with its individual id, played predominantly by Females for the collegiate and newbie ranges, however Adult men's leagues also exist.

Industry Proportions and Equipment
Among the most recognizable differences concerning baseball and softball lies in the field dimensions and devices:

Ball Size: Softballs are substantially much larger, typically 11 to 12 inches in circumference, although baseballs are about nine inches. Softballs also are softer towards the touch.

Bat Distinctions: Softball bats usually are shorter, lighter, and possess a thinner barrel in comparison to baseball bats.

Discipline Measurement: A regular baseball subject is much bigger. The distance involving bases is ninety toes in baseball and sixty ft in softball. The pitching distance can be increased—60 feet 6 inches in baseball vs. forty three toes (fastpitch) or 46 feet (slowpitch) in softball.

Pitching Fashion: Baseball pitchers throw overhand or sidearm from the mound, when softball pitchers supply the ball underhand from a flat circle.

Recreation Perform and Technique
Regardless of their similarities, the dynamics of gameplay can vary greatly:

Activity Duration: Baseball video games are typically 9 innings prolonged, although regulation softball games are 7 innings.

Tempo of Perform: Softball has a tendency to be more rapidly-paced a result of the smaller sized field and shorter foundation paths, DV88 which means more rapidly plays and more emphasis on pace and reaction time.

Pitching Impression: In softball, due to underhand movement and closer pitching distance, hitters ought to react more quickly, and pitchers can dominate a lot more easily with pace and spin. In baseball, pitchers have more area to vary pitch forms and velocities because of the bigger distance and overhand shipping.

Scoring: While equally game titles could be superior- or minimal-scoring, softball generally attributes far more strategic small-ball methods like bunting and foundation thieving because of the condensed discipline sizing.

Cultural and Competitive Variances
During the U.S., baseball has long been an experienced Adult men's Activity, though softball is now the premier competitive group sport for Females, In particular within the highschool and collegiate levels. Title IX within the U.S. helped develop Females’s softball packages in universities, Whilst Qualified Gals’s baseball hardly ever made in the same way.
